First Weeks at Björn Borg

Hi!

I have finished the second week of my internship at Björn Borg in Stockholm! I am working in the Production Department in the Souring team. The Sourcing team consists of two others who graduated from our same programme in Textile Value Chain Management at the University of Borås, so I feel really lucky to have their insight and support. Björn Borg, as a sports fashion brand, has a strong company culture in health and fitness, so many people train everyday, but on Fridays we have mandatory group training with a personal trainer! 

My experience so far consists on joining meetings with our Tier 1 suppliers in which we follow up on production, Covid restrictions and delays, confirm timeframes, and work to improve sustainability and performance. I attend meetings and webinars related to Björn Borg's sustainability strategy improving economic, environmental and social sustainability performance. I am also assisting in quality control in which we perform hands-on tests on sample products as well as evaluate quality reports coming directly from inline and final production. My individual tasks include conducting a benchmark report on the social compliancy auditor we currently use and compare the other options to see if they would like to switch providers in the future. Social compliancy auditor services allow us to monitor and improve the social performance of our vendors across the supply chain, so this includes maintaining standards such as fair wages and no child labour. The Sourcing team works directly with vendors to encourage and empower them to improve their social responsibility and environmental sustainability through incentives, education and maintaining a strong working relationship. It's been a challenging experience so far, but there is a considerable amount of overlap between what we've studied at university and what I'm doing in the workplace, so I'm very glad to have this internship opportunity.
